>백엔드 개발 >PHP 튜토리얼 >MySQL 테이블의 기본값은 null이지만 laravel에서 들어오는 null 값을 처리하는 올바른 방법은 무엇입니까?

MySQL 테이블의 기본값은 null이지만 laravel에서 들어오는 null 값을 처리하는 올바른 방법은 무엇입니까?

WBOY
WBOY원래의
2016-12-01 00:25:201630검색

손으로 작성해야 하기 때문에 많은 양식이 텍스트이고 필드는 기본적으로 int 및 null이므로 입력할 필요가 없습니다.

입력시 입력하지 않으면 ''가 전달되고 오류가 발생합니다. 이러한 필드가 많기 때문에 어떻게 처리하는 것이 가장 좋은가요?

답글 내용:

손으로 작성해야 하기 때문에 많은 양식이 텍스트이고 필드는 기본적으로 int 및 null이므로 입력할 필요가 없습니다.

입력시 입력하지 않으면 ''가 전달되고 오류가 발생합니다. 이러한 필드가 많기 때문에 어떻게 처리하는 것이 가장 좋은가요?

노력을 절약하고 싶다면 모델의 저장 기능을 오버로드하세요

내부의 모든 속성을 순회하고 모든 빈 문자열 값을 설정 해제한 다음 상위 클래스의 저장 함수를 호출합니다.

int 유형의 기본값은 0입니다

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.